An import was cancelled but the background process is still running. I tried going to 'active cluster nodes' to kill the transaction but it still appears when the page reloads. How can I kill this process because it is slowing performance on the node

Please try to do two more things:
- access to https://instance_name.service-now.com/cancel_my_transaction.do, see if you get any transaction from this page, if so cancel it (I tried in my personal instance, I sgot the message "All transaction have completed, nothing to cancel")
- try to follow the kill active transactions steps above with another admin user
